# Generate transport/runtime artifacts FROM a URI scheme binding spec.
#
# The binding (uri + JSON-Schema inputSchema + kind + adapter) is the single
# source of truth. From it we generate, deterministically:
#   * protobuf + gRPC service   (one rpc per route, typed messages from the schema)
#   * an OpenAPI 3 document      (one path per route, requestBody from the schema)
#   * a typed Python client      (one function per route)
# Add a target = add a generator, never re-spec. This is the N×M → N+M move.
